Can GeForce RTX 4060 Ti run Sausage Legend: Arena?
GreatThe GeForce RTX 4060 Ti handles Sausage Legend: Arena well at 1080p, delivering approximately 359 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 269 FPS.
Sausage Legend: Arena – GeForce RTX 4060 Ti FPS Data
| Quality | 1080p | 1440p | 4K |
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| 561 fps | 420 fps | 224 fps |
| Medium | 448 fps | 336 fps | 179 fps |
| High | 359 fps | 269 fps | 143 fps |
| Ultra | 291 fps | 219 fps | 117 fps |
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ings

Sausage Legend: Arena is designed to be accessible, making it easy to run even on entry-level hardware. A G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T will handle the game comfortably at 1080p with medium settings, ensuring a smooth gameplay experience without significant frame drops. Players with more powerful graphics cards, such as the GTX 1660 or RX 6600, can expect to push settings to high and enjoy higher resolutions, potentially up to 1440p while maintaining solid performance.
For those on older or less powerful systems, you can still enjoy the game with lower settings and resolution, targeting 720p for a decent experience. The game's relatively low hardware demands mean that it’s a great option for casual gamers and those looking to play on a budget. Overall, if you have at least an entry-level GPU and 8 GB of RAM, you'll find Sausage Legend: Arena to be a fun and engaging title that runs well on most systems.
